The Growth Hormone Releasing Peptide, In Plain Words

You might be curious about what exactly sermorelin acetate is and how it works. It’s a synthetic peptide that mimics a naturally occurring hormone in your body. This hormone signals your pituitary gland to release more of its own growth hormone. Think of it as a gentle nudge to your body’s natural production system.

This GHRH analog works by binding to specific receptors in the pituitary gland. When activated, these receptors stimulate the release of growth hormone in a pulsatile manner, similar to how your body produces it naturally. This targeted approach aims to restore more youthful patterns of hormone secretion.

The resulting increase in growth hormone can support various bodily functions. It plays a role in cell repair and regeneration, muscle growth, fat metabolism, and even cognitive function. For many individuals seeking healthy aging support, these effects are highly desirable.

Is Sermorelin FDA Approved

It is important to understand that while sermorelin acetate itself is a well-studied peptide, compounded sermorelin prescriptions are dispensed under specific pharmacy regulations, namely sections 503A and 503B of the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act. These regulations govern the compounding of medications by licensed pharmacies and are not equivalent to separate FDA approval for a finished drug product. Your clinician prescribes it based on medical necessity within these regulatory frameworks.

How often do I take the injection

The typical regimen involves daily subcutaneous injections, often administered in the evening before bed. Your clinician will provide detailed instructions on the correct dosage and injection technique tailored to your individual needs. Consistency is vital for achieving the desired therapeutic effects.

What about side effects?

Reported side effects are generally mild and include injection site redness, transient flushing and occasional headache. Sermorelin uses your own pituitary gland, which tends to be safer than synthetic HGH because the body retains its natural feedback loop.
